Great Interest in Eruption says Hotel Owner

Fridrik Pálsson, owner of luxury Hotel Rangá close to the eruption in Fimmvörduháls, says that his phone has not stopped since the eruption started. “I was at a convention in Hólmavík on the West fjords last night when a staff member at the hotel called me to tell me that an eruption had started.

Hotel
This was just before midnight and I jumped into my car and drove all night to come to the hotel as soon as possible.”
The Hótel Rangá is close to Hvolsvöllur where the rescue center is located. All guests were always safe. They were excited to be in the place at the moment of outbreak. At the moment the only sign of the eruption they see is the thick smoke.

“People are calling us from near and far. Many scientists want to know how close they can get to the area, if they can rent planes or helicopters, etc.”
Pálsson says that even though the road to the area is closed, police allow hotel guests to pass through. But what about vacancies at the hotel, if people want to get close to the scene?
“We have been packed in recent weeks, but for some odd coincidence we have space this week. But if the number of phone calls I receive are any indication those will be filled soon” Pálsson says.

"One last question. What was the convention in Hólmavík that you had to leave so abruptly about?"
"On humor. And unlike most such scholarly work on wit, it was quite entertaining," Pálsson says.

Erupting Iceland volcano to be tourist attraction?

“It’s going well, right now we’re investigating tourist access to the area and how we can do that best,” says Vidir Reynisson, section chief of Iceland’s Civil Protection Department about plans to allow tourists to start visiting the active volcano in southern Iceland.

According to Reynisson, if their safety can be protected, there is no reason to continue preventing tourist access.

Bad weather has affected South Iceland last night and this morning, obscuring the view of the eruption and gas cloud. Reynisson says however that the Civil Protection Department’s work is going well and that the volcano is being closely monitored. The department has called its scientific advisers to a meeting this morning, where the volcano’s status and likely future developments are being discussed.
The volcano at Fimmvorduhals seems to have changed little since yesterday; although changes in intensity can come fast and with little warning.

Tourists come to see the Iceland volcano Eruption

Many foreigners have come to Iceland exclusively to see the eruption. There are many ways to get close to the eruption.

Four helicopters fly non-stop sight-seeing flights over the glacier and it is also possible to go in SUVs or snowmobiles.

The first few days after the eruption started there were not so many foreign tourists, but that has changed. According to Hótel Rangá’s owner Fridrik Pálsson many are now coming only to see the eruption. Most are fathers coming with their children.

Many tourist companies offer rides over the eruption on helicopters or planes. A one hour special costs about 250 euros. It is necessary to reserve places in advance.

Iceland volcano coming to an end?

There are now clear indications that the Eyjafjallajokull volcanic eruption in South Iceland is about to stop.

Volcanic activity in the area has decreased rapidly over the last day. The journalist, environmentalist and aviator, Omar Ragnarsson flew over the volcano this morning and saw no ash production at all, according to Visir.is.

Volcanologists at the Icelandic Met Office say that a small upsurge occurred at around midday yesterday, but say volcanic activity has been decreasing ever since. It is, however, not yet possible to say that the eruption is definitely stopping. Scientists are on their way to the volcano this afternoon to investigate.
